Influence of Multiple Risk Factor Management on the Onset and Progression of Chronic Kidney Disease in Patients With
Xinyi Peng1,2, Shuohua Chen3, Shouling Wu3
1Hypertension Center, Beijing Anzhen Hospital Capital Medical University, Beijing Institute of Heart, Lung, and Blood Vessel Diseases Beijing China.
Background:
Patients with hypertension face a significantly elevated risk of renal dysfunction. However, whether this risk can be mitigated by joint risk factor control remains uncertain.
Methods:
Using Cox proportional hazards models, this study investigated the association between the number of controlled baseline risk factors (systolic blood pressure, low-density lipoprotein cholesterol, fasting blood glucose, and body mass index) and the development and progression of chronic kidney disease.
Results:
We analyzed 77 356 participants with hypertension and 1:1 age- and sex-matched counterparts without hypertension for incident chronic kidney disease over a median follow-up of 13.40 years. Among participants with hypertension, each additional controlled risk factor was associated with an 18% lower risk of chronic kidney disease (hazard ratio [HR], 0.82 [95% CI, 0.81-0.84]), and controlling all 4 factors (versus ≤1) reduced the risk by 42% (HR, 0.58 [95% CI, 0.52-0.63]). Effective multifactorial management progressively narrowed the risk gap between hypertensive and normotensive individuals. Chronic kidney disease progression was assessed in 9543 participants with hypertension and 6799 participants without hypertension over 11.88 years. Each additional controlled risk factor was associated with an 18% lower progression risk (HR, 0.82 [95% CI, 0.78-0.86]). Controlling 3 factors was sufficient to eliminate the excess progression risk between groups with hypertension and groups without hypertension, while controlling all 4 factors lowered the risk by 31% (HR, 0.69 [95% CI, 0.53-0.89]).
Conclusions:
This study demonstrates a clear dose-response relationship between the number of controlled risk factors and the magnitude of kidney risk reduction. A comprehensive, multifactorial control strategy can progressively reduce and potentially normalize the excess kidney risk in hypertensive individuals. These findings support a more quantitative and stage-specific approach to hypertension management.
